Key Facts

Date of Event
May 21, 1991.
Location of Event
Sriperumbudur, Tamil Nadu, India.
Number of People Who Died
At least 15 people, including Rajiv Gandhi and the bomber.
Group Involved
Liberation Tigers of Tamil Eelam (LTTE).

Who Was the Bomber?

The person who caused the explosion was a young woman named Kalaivani Rajaratnam, but she used other names too. She was part of a group from another country called Sri Lanka. This group was fighting for their own country.

They were very unhappy with India because India had sent soldiers to help in a big fight in Sri Lanka. This young woman believed that by doing this terrible thing, she was helping her own people, but it caused so much pain.
